Hardness of water
Question

Statement-I: Permanent hardness of water is removed by treatment with washing soda.

Statement-II: Washing soda reacts with soluble magnesium and calcium sulphate to form insoluble carbonates.

Moderate
Solution

Permanent hardness of water is due to calcium or magnesium sulphate and chloride ions which can be removed by reacting with soda (Na2CO3) through formation of insoluble carbonates
